aboutsummaryrefslogtreecommitdiffstats
path: root/binding/config_iiodevices.h
diff options
context:
space:
mode:
authorJan-Simon Moeller <jsmoeller@linuxfoundation.org>2018-06-29 00:03:52 +0000
committerGerrit Code Review <gerrit@automotivelinux.org>2018-06-29 00:03:52 +0000
commit1b38f28dcbf2f51b17e8ec8f647db40f4b919258 (patch)
treec4b11ed74432593f118465b0477cf879b2c5cb67 /binding/config_iiodevices.h
parentc68bc1899070aefd9e84096fa627bee18e3c0dcb (diff)
parentffab6de9c0e87fa8019d6a090d847b9017d2e015 (diff)
Merge "Remove useless code and declare iio_infos in C code"
Diffstat (limited to 'binding/config_iiodevices.h')
-rw-r--r--binding/config_iiodevices.h9
1 files changed, 1 insertions, 8 deletions
diff --git a/binding/config_iiodevices.h b/binding/config_iiodevices.h
index 9e99045..85189bc 100644
--- a/binding/config_iiodevices.h
+++ b/binding/config_iiodevices.h
@@ -9,20 +9,13 @@
struct iio_info {
const char *dev_name;
const char *id;
-};
-
-#define IIO_INFOS_SIZE 3
-static struct iio_info iio_infos[IIO_INFOS_SIZE] = {
- { "16-001d", "accel"},
- { "16-001d", "magn"},
- { "16-006b", "anglvel"}
+ const char *middlename;
};
enum iio_elements { X = 1, Y = 2, Z = 4 };
void set_channel_name(char *name, enum iio_elements iioelts);
enum iio_elements treat_iio_elts(const char *iioelts_string);
-enum iio_infos treat_iio_infos(const char *infos);
int get_iio_nb(enum iio_elements iioelts);
#endif //_CONFIG_IIODEVICES_